首页
建站知识
建站知识
/
2025/4/2 23:14:22
http://www.tqpw.cn/aayD8GY9.shtml
相关文章
《计算机组成原理:硬件/软件接口》(MIPS版)第二章:MISP汇编指令
本文目录 前言一. MISP32指令集概述二. MISP三类汇编指令1. MISP的三种指令格式1.1 机器码字段和寄存器号1.2 指令格式 2. 运算指令3. 数据传送指令3.1 装载32位立即数 4. 决策分支指令4.1 if-else型翻译4.2 while型翻译 5. 指令小结 三. MISP中的五种寻址方式1. 立即数寻址和寄…
阅读更多...
流水线的Hazard检测与解决 学习记录四
RISC-SPM 学习记录 一-CSDN博客 RSIC_SPM 学习记录二_br(branch)指令-CSDN博客 一.流水线(Pipelined)CPU 为了实现更高的时钟速度和性能,我们可以将指令的顺序处理分离到 CPU 中。然后将每个子进程分配给独立的处理单元。这些处理单元按顺序级联以形成流水线。所有…
阅读更多...
CPU设计实战第五章
第四章内容可以参照该篇文章 文章目录 一、算术逻辑运算类指令的添加*1.ADD、ADDI、SUB指令的添加**2.SLTI、SLTIU指令的添加**3.ANDI、ORI、XORI指令的添加**4.SLLV、SRLV、SRAV指令的添加* 二、乘除法运算类指令的添加*1.迭代除法器**2.乘法器**3.特殊寄存器HILO的添加**4.例…
阅读更多...
汇编指令分析
目录 1.寻址模式 2.条件跳转 3.中断 4.递归函数的底层逻辑 5.汇编语言实现6的阶乘递归函数 计算机通过指令指挥计算机工作。 CPU被时钟驱动,不断读取PC指针指向的指令,并移动PC指针,从内存中读取指令并执行(周而复始&#x…
阅读更多...
PicoRV32 笔记 06 压缩指令集
PicoRV32 中实现压缩指令集选项 COMPRESSED_ISA,当设置COMPRESSED_ISA1开启支持16位指令集。压缩指令有很多优点,当我们在FPGA中实现PicoRV32的时候,使用RISCV的C扩展能有效的增大代码密度,原本32位1条指令变为16位一条指令&#…
阅读更多...
HNU-计算机体系结构-实验1-RISC-V流水线
计算机体系结构 实验1 计科210X 甘晴void 202108010XXX 1 实验目的 参考提供为了更好的理解RISC-V,通过学习RV32I Core的设计图,理解每条指令的数据流和控制信号,为之后指令流水线及乱序发射实验打下基础。 参考资料: RISC-…
阅读更多...
制作一个RISC-V的操作系统五-RISC-V汇编语言编程四(伪指令和指令 addi 基于算数运算实现的相关伪指令 addi指令的局限性 LUI(构造高20位) 练习 lui和addi联合使用 li)
文章目录 伪指令和指令addi基于算数运算实现的相关伪指令addi指令的局限性LUI(构造高20位)练习lui和addi联合使用liauipcla小结 伪指令和指令 在讨论RISC-V架构中的伪指令与指令的区别之前,我们先了解一下什么是指令和伪指令。 指令(Instructions&…
阅读更多...
RV32G下lui/auipc和addi结合加载立即数时的补值问题
一、问题描述与解决思路 在32位下,lui/auipc通常用来取一个32位数的高20位,并且是带符号操作,将最高位默认为符号位。那么,取完最高位20位之后,再取低12位的时候,会面临一个补值问题。 假设这个32位内容为正数,lui/auipc取高20位的时候本身没问题,但是后续再对剩余的…
阅读更多...
自己动手写CPU(6)简单算术操作指令
指令说明 MIPS32指令集架构定义的所有算术操作指令,共有三类,分别是: 简单算术指令乘累加、乘累减指令除法指令 本博客先记录简单算术操作指令 简单算术操作指令一共有15条指令分别是:add、addi、addiu、addu、sub、subu、clo…
阅读更多...
RISC-V:实现ADDI指令
0 实验要求 实验整体框架已给出,任务主要包括: 数据窗口的添加(可选,我添加了)立即数生成错误修改(老师主动设置错误,修改见代码)三端口寄存器模块的添加(这与此前的三端口略有不同,注意重点查看RegisterFile模块的实现)1 源代码 `default_nettype none /…
阅读更多...
尚硅谷Docker笔记(7)-- Docker常用安装
一、总体步骤 搜索镜像拉取镜像查看镜像启动镜像停止容器移除容器二、安装tomcat 1、docker hub上面查找tomcat镜像 docker search tomcat 2、从docker hub上拉取tomcat镜像到本地 docker pull tomcat 1官网命令 2拉取完成 3、docker images查看是否有拉取到的tomcat…
阅读更多...
centos7系统 用docker安装redis的保姆教程
一、临时方式(不可取,需要用挂载文件) 使用docker搜索 命令:docker search redis下载镜像 docker pull 镜像名称例如 docker pull bitnami/trdis 而bitnami/trdis是搜索镜像出来的名称,不能更改 为镜像创建一个容器格式是…
阅读更多...
redis-server.exe双击闪退 win10系统
博客 解决方法: 1-winR 打开命令行 2-cd至redis目录,例如 D:\redis> 3-输入 redis-server.exe redis.windows.conf 4-若启动redis出现 [****] *****(当前日期)****** # Creating Server TCP listening socket *:6379: listen: Unknown error 更改red…
阅读更多...
centos7 systemd 开机自启动脚本配置方法 redis开机自启动
centos7 systemd 开机自启动脚本配置方法 1、步骤如下1.1、安装依赖包1.2、编译安装redis1.3、复制redis解压后utils目录下的service文件1.3.1、修改service文件注意1.3.2、可参考的service文件1.3.3、修改配置文件注意设置1.3.4、可参考的配置文件 1.4、重启服务器测试redis自…
阅读更多...
Win10+VirtualBox+Openstack Mitaka
首先VirtualBox安装的话,没有什么可演示的,去官网(https://www.virtualbox.org/wiki/Downloads)下载,或者可以去(https://www.virtualbox.org/wiki/Download_Old_Builds)下载旧版本。 接下来设置…
阅读更多...
Spring Boot引起的“堆外内存泄漏”排查及经验总结7
背景 为了更好地实现对项目的管理,我们将组内一个项目迁移到MDP框架(基于Spring Boot),随后我们就发现系统会频繁报出Swap区域使用量过高的异常。笔者被叫去帮忙查看原因,发现配置了4G堆内内存,但是实际使…
阅读更多...
00. 这里整理了最全的爬虫框架(Java + Python)
目录 1、前言 2、什么是网络爬虫 3、常见的爬虫框架 3.1、java框架 3.1.1、WebMagic 3.1.2、Jsoup 3.1.3、HttpClient 3.1.4、Crawler4j 3.1.5、HtmlUnit 3.1.6、Selenium 3.2、Python框架 3.2.1、Scrapy 3.2.2、BeautifulSoup Requests 3.2.3、Selenium 3.2.4…
阅读更多...
centos7+Docker快速入门
centos7Docker快速入门 Docker安装 # 确定版本是7以上 [rootlizhw /]# cat /etc/redhat-release# yum安装gcc [rootlizhw /]# yum -y install gcc [rootlizhw /]# yum -y install gcc-c# 卸载旧版本 [rootlizhw /]# yum remove docker \docker-client \docker-client-latest …
阅读更多...
CentOS7使用Docker安装Redis图文教程
1.拉取Redis镜像 这里制定了版本,不指定默认latest最新版 docker pull redis:6.0.8提示信息如下即为下载成功 2.上传配置文件 官方配置文件(找自己对应的版本):reids.conf 或者将如下配置文件命名为redis.conf,上…
阅读更多...
Docker7_常用安装
文章目录 Docker常用安装1.总体步骤2.安装tomcat3.安装mysql4.安装redis Docker常用安装 1.总体步骤 搜索镜像 拉取镜像 查看镜像 启动镜像 停止容器 移除容器 2.安装tomcat docker hub上面查找tomcat镜像。 docker search tomcat从docker hub上拉取tomcat镜像到本地。 d…
阅读更多...
推荐文章
python爬取路况信息查询_如何一键获取高德交通态势数据
怎么做网站呀?如何做网站?
手机摄影专业模式
教你如何做原型设计
程序员必备网页前端设计网站
电商网站的基本需求
AI绘图奇谭:赛博画师如何化身“造字鬼才”
C++ STL set_intersection 用法
intersection函数python_python -- 函数、集合
Intersection over Union
探索 Intersection Observer API:提升网页性能的新途径
Intersection Observer 实现图片懒加载